Quick note for support folks triaging pagination complaints on the Lumoria public API: cursors expire after 15 minutes, so "invalid cursor" tickets are usually just stale tabs. Ask the customer to re-request page one before escalating. If you need to reproduce locally, spin up the sandbox with the standard env file, which needs the signing secret on the next line.

vault entry, kafog-yahop: COURIER_KEY8=0faa53ae

Memo — prototype shipment to Gaviston Test Labs

The two Redpine prototype units ship Wednesday. Pack in the foam-lined case from the supply room, anti-static wrap on both boards. No markings on the outer box. Courier pickup is booked for 14:00 from reception. One item is confidential and appended directly below.

dispatch memo: the lamwyn fenwyn courier leaves the wenir ledger at gate 7175 under passcode 822969

Handover Note — Franchise Agreement, Quillon Coffee Works. I'm passing the Northgate franchise file to you in good order. The agreement with the Merrow family runs through 2027; royalty terms were renegotiated last spring and are documented carefully in the deal folder. Sales leads should be briefed on territory boundaries before expansion talks resume. One confidential point follows for your eyes.

board note of tawig-bajof: The renewal with Ralixix Holdings closes at $10 million a year, 20 percent above the last contract. Project Druix slips by two quarters because of the tooling delay.

Support team: while investigating why soft-deleted rows in the Milbrook orders table (`deleted_at` set, not purged) were reappearing in customer exports, we found the audit credentials are kept in the Larchfield vault, which is currently locked after too many failed unlock attempts. Until it's reopened, we cannot confirm which export job ignores the `deleted_at` flag. The vault operator confirmed the lockout clears with a manual recovery unlock, which requires the passphrase noted directly below.

unlock words, bahop-fawef: novmir-druwyn-soriel-rusdor-kasion